C4 Therapeutics (CCCC) Q2 2026 earnings summary
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.
Q2 2026 earnings summary
11 Aug, 2026Executive summary
Entered a new research collaboration and license agreement with Roche, granting Roche exclusive global rights to develop, manufacture, and commercialize Degrader-Antibody Conjugates (DACs) for two initial oncology targets, with an option for a third target.
C4T will use its proprietary technology to design degrader payloads, while Roche will handle antibody selection, conjugation, and all downstream development and commercialization.
Advanced cemsidomide clinical development with ongoing Phase 2 MOMENTUM and Phase 1b combination trials, both on track for key data readouts in 2027.
Presented Phase 1 data at EHA 2026 Congress, supporting cemsidomide's potential best-in-class profile in multiple myeloma.
Raised $33.5 million in net proceeds via ATM program to support clinical advancement and trial planning.
Financial highlights
Roche paid a $20 million upfront, non-refundable, non-creditable payment to C4T.
C4T is eligible for over $1 billion in aggregate milestone payments across discovery, regulatory, and commercial milestones, plus tiered royalties on future net sales.
Q2 2026 revenue was $6.6 million, up from $6.5 million in Q2 2025, mainly due to the Roche collaboration.
R&D expenses decreased to $24.5 million from $26.2 million year-over-year, primarily due to lower personnel costs.
Cash, cash equivalents, and marketable securities totaled $300.4 million as of June 30, 2026, expected to fund operations through end of 2028.
Outlook and guidance
The agreement provides C4T with significant non-dilutive funding and long-term revenue potential through milestones and royalties.
Roche assumes all costs and responsibilities for development, regulatory approval, manufacturing, and commercialization, reducing C4T's financial risk.
MOMENTUM Phase 2 trial enrollment expected to complete in Q1 2027, with initial ORR data in 2H 2027.
Phase 1b combination trial with elranatamab progressing, with dose escalation update in 2H 2026 and full cohort data in mid-2027.
Current cash position projected to fund operations through 2028.
